            <abstract>
                <p>
                    <bold>Background:</bold> The contribution of sudden unexpected infant death (SUID) has received little attention in global health. The objective of this study was to estimate the burden of SUID in Lusaka, Zambia.</p>
                <p>
                    <bold>Methods:</bold> Verbal autopsies were conducted on infants who died in Lusaka, between 2017 and 2020.  From these, we performed a qualitative analysis of the free text narratives of the final series of events leading to each infant&#x2019;s death and classified these as symptomatic deaths or SUID. Any narrative that described an infant who was otherwise healthy with no antecedent illness prior to death and found dead in bed after a sleep episode was classified as SUID. We used logistic regression to test for statistical differences between asymptomatic deaths and SUIDs on key infant, maternal and other risk factors of SUIDs.</p>
                <p>
                    <bold>Results:</bold> Eight hundred and nine verbal autopsies were conducted with families of decedent infants younger than six months of age. A total of 92.6% (749/809) had presented with symptoms prior to death, whereas 7.4% (60/809) died without preceding symptoms or obvious cause of death. Of these, 16/60 were compatible with accidental suffocation deaths, and 54/60 appeared to be sudden infant death syndrome.  SUID deaths were concentrated in infants younger than two months of age with peak age of one to two months. Age at death was the only significant factor in multivariate analysis. Infants aged between one and two months had 2.84 increased odds of suspected SUIDs compared to infants in the first month of life (aOR = 2.84, 95% CI: 1.31, 6.16).</p>
                <p>
                    <bold>Conclusions:</bold> Our findings suggest SUID could be accounting for a significant proportion of infant deaths in Zambia, but this cause of infant mortality is going unrecognized. Public health interventions in Zambia, and Africa more broadly, are likely overlooking SUIDs as an important cause of infant mortality.</p>

        <sec sec-type="intro">
            <title>Introduction</title>
            <p>Child mortality rates in sub-Saharan Africa are particularly high. In 2019, more than half of the global under-five mortalities occurred in sub-Saharan Africa
                <sup>
                    <xref ref-type="bibr" rid="ref-1">1</xref>
                </sup>. Nearly one child in 13 dies before reaching the age of five in sub-Saharan Africa
                <sup>
                    <xref ref-type="bibr" rid="ref-1">1</xref>
                </sup>. The risk of dying before the age of five is almost 20 times higher in sub-Saharan Africa compared to countries in other WHO regions
                <sup>
                    <xref ref-type="bibr" rid="ref-1">1</xref>
                </sup>. Sadly, most of these deaths are preventable. Zambia like other countries in Africa is similarly burdened by high rates of child mortality. In 2018, the under-five mortality rate in Zambia was estimated to be 61 per 1000 live births, nearly two times the global under-five mortality rate
                <sup>
                    <xref ref-type="bibr" rid="ref-2">2</xref>
                </sup>. A total of 69% of the country&#x2019;s child mortality occurred in children under one year of age
                <sup>
                    <xref ref-type="bibr" rid="ref-2">2</xref>
                </sup>. The infant mortality rate was almost four times the global infant mortality rate (42 vs 11 per 1000 live births)
                <sup>
                    <xref ref-type="bibr" rid="ref-2">2</xref>
                </sup>. While infectious diseases such as pneumonia, and malaria are recognized as leading causes of child mortality in Zambia, the contribution of sleep related conditions such as sudden unexpected infant death (SUID) to child mortality is less well documented.</p>
            <p>SUID includes sudden infant death syndrome (SIDS) and accidental suffocation and strangulation in bed (ASSB). SIDS is currently one of the leading causes of preventable infant mortality in wealthier countries and is defined as the sudden unexpected death of an infant less than one year of age where cause of death remains unexplained even after an autopsy and death scene investigation, and where the event occurred after a sleep episode
                <sup>
                    <xref ref-type="bibr" rid="ref-3">3</xref>
                </sup>. National infant mortality statistics in Zambia rarely include data on SIDS or SUID. The prevailing view in Zambia and most African countries is that SIDS is not an important cause of infant mortality. This need not be the case since SIDS has consistently been identified as a leading cause of infant mortality wherever it has been studied. For instance, even in South Africa, mortality due to SIDS is particularly high compared to high-income countries such as the U.S., Australia and the U.K., with estimated rates of between 3.01 to 3.70 per 1000 live births
                <sup>
                    <xref ref-type="bibr" rid="ref-4">4</xref>,
                    <xref ref-type="bibr" rid="ref-5">5</xref>
                </sup>. South Africa is an outlier on the African continent with relatively better socio-economic conditions compared to other countries in Africa including Zambia. SIDS rates in Zambia are likely to be higher since the socio-economic risk factors for SIDS, young maternal age, poor maternal education and low income, are prevalent in Zambia.</p>
            <p>Zambia has made tremendous progress in reducing its infant mortality rates from 107 in 1992 to 42 in 2018
                <sup>
                    <xref ref-type="bibr" rid="ref-2">2</xref>
                </sup>. To sustain this progress, the contribution of less well documented causes of infant mortality such as SIDS/SUIDs need to be investigated. The objective of this study was to estimate the burden of SIDS/SUIDs in a representative African country such as Zambia using free text narratives from a modified verbal autopsy tool. To guide this study, our research question was &#x2018;What proportion of decedent infants died suddenly and unexpectedly during sleep in Lusaka, Zambia&#x2019;?</p>

        <sec sec-type="methods">
            <title>Methods</title>
            <sec>
                <title>Study setting</title>
                <p>Data collection for this study occurred in Lusaka, the capital city of Zambia. Lusaka has a predominantly urban population (84%) of 1.7 million. It is surrounded by unofficial peri-urban compounds/towns where most of the city&#x2019;s poor reside bringing the total population of Lusaka to approximately 2.4 million individuals, or roughly 1/8th of the total population of Zambia itself. A dozen primary health facilities provide health care to the population with the University Teaching Hospital (UTH) serving as the main referral facility
                    <sup>
                        <xref ref-type="bibr" rid="ref-6">6</xref>
                    </sup>. UTH is the largest hospital in Zambia with 1655 beds and serves as the main training institution for doctors, nurses and other clinical officers
                    <sup>
                        <xref ref-type="bibr" rid="ref-7">7</xref>,
                        <xref ref-type="bibr" rid="ref-8">8</xref>
                    </sup>.</p>
                <p>Data was collected as part of the Zambian Pertussis/RSV Infant Mortality Estimation (ZPRIME) project. The ZPRIME project, a Bill and Melinda Gates sponsored project, was a post-mortem prevalence study designed to identify the proportion of deaths aged four days to less than six months that were attributable to 
                    <italic toggle="yes">Bordetella pertussis</italic> and respiratory syncytial virus (RSV) in Lusaka, Zambia
                    <sup>
                        <xref ref-type="bibr" rid="ref-9">9</xref>
                    </sup>. ZPRIME enrolled deceased subjects aged four days to less than six months who died in UTH or in the community and presented at the UTH morgue
                    <sup>
                        <xref ref-type="bibr" rid="ref-9">9</xref>
                    </sup>. Ethical approval for ZPRIME was provided by the institutional review board at the University of Zambia (Ref. No. 2017-May-053, Approval date: 07/21/2017) and Boston University Medical Center (IRB Number: H-36469, Approval date: 06/06/2017).</p>
            </sec>
            <sec>
                <title>Study population</title>
                <p>For this present study, we focus on infant deaths that occurred in the community. Verbal autopsies (VA) were conducted with families and/or caregivers of 809 decedents aged four days to six months who presented at the University Teaching Hospital Morgue (UTH) as BIDs (Brought in dead).</p>
                <p>An infant was eligible for a verbal autopsy if the infant had died:</p>
                <list list-type="bullet">
                    <list-item>
                        <p>before arrival at a health facility or</p>
                    </list-item>
                    <list-item>
                        <p>during receipt of outpatient care at a health facility
                            <sup>
                                <xref ref-type="bibr" rid="ref-6">6</xref>
                            </sup> or</p>
                    </list-item>
                    <list-item>
                        <p>during referral to a higher level of care without admission at a health facility
                            <sup>
                                <xref ref-type="bibr" rid="ref-6">6</xref>
                            </sup>
                        </p>
                    </list-item>
                </list>
            </sec>
            <sec>
                <title>Data collection</title>
                <p>Data collectors trained in grief counselling conducted verbal autopsies with families of eligible infants using an abbreviated verbal autopsy tool with close ended questions about the symptoms immediately preceding the infant&#x2019;s death. An open response narrative question encouraged respondents to describe, in as much detail as possible, the circumstances leading to the infant&#x2019;s death. The open response field was prompted by the question: &#x201c;Now, using your own words, please describe the events leading up to your child&#x2019;s death. Please take as much time as you need and be as detailed as you can.&#x201d;
                    <sup>
                        <xref ref-type="bibr" rid="ref-6">6</xref>
                    </sup> The VA tool modified for use in this study was the IHME-modified version of the verbal autopsy tool created and validated by the Population Health Metrics Research Consortium (PHMRC) (
                    <ext-link ext-link-type="uri" xlink:href="https://static-content.springer.com/esm/art:10.1186/s12916-015-0528-8/MediaObjects/12916_2015_528_MOESM3_ESM.docx">PHMRC: Shortened verbal autopsy instrument</ext-link>)
                    <sup>
                        <xref ref-type="bibr" rid="ref-9">9</xref>,
                        <xref ref-type="bibr" rid="ref-10">10</xref>
                    </sup>.</p>
                <p>Data collectors were notified if an eligible BID decedent presented at the UTH Morgue. Informed consent was sought from respondents and those who gave consent were interviewed. In addition to the VA tool, demographic information such as maternal and paternal education, occupation, and household census was collected. We also collected data on the closest clinic where the infant usually received care as a proxy for the location of the residence. In total, 809 verbal autopsies (VAs) were conducted between August 2017 and August 2020 as part of ZPRIME. Please see the underlying data
                    <sup>
                        <xref ref-type="bibr" rid="ref-11">11</xref>
                    </sup>.</p>
            </sec>
            <sec>
                <title>Coding and statistical analysis</title>
                <p>To estimate the proportion of infants who died suddenly and unexpectedly, we focused our analysis on the open response narrative in the VA tool. We did this in two steps. Firstly, we qualitatively coded the free text narratives in 
                    <ext-link ext-link-type="uri" xlink:href="https://www.microsoft.com/en-gb/">Microsoft Excel</ext-link> 2021 (RRID:SCR_016137) and classified the responses into symptomatic and asymptomatic (suspected SUIDs) deaths based on reports of danger signs of ill health within the week immediately preceding death. Any narrative with reports of fever, difficulty breathing, cough, hospital admissions or other symptoms within the week immediately preceding death were classified as symptomatic deaths and assigned a score of 0. Any narrative that described an infant who was otherwise healthy with no antecedent illness prior to death or reported to have no symptoms or hospital admissions in the week prior to death and reported to be found dead in bed after a sleep episode were classified as asymptomatic deaths or suspected SUID and assigned a score of 1.</p>
                <p>We further classified the asymptomatic deaths into unexplained (possible SIDS) and explained deaths (possible suffocation/smothering (ASSB)). A SUID death was explained if the narrative suggested suffocation or smothering as the likely cause of death based on:</p>
                <list list-type="bullet">
                    <list-item>
                        <p>finding of blood or vomitus/milk from the nose/mouth after bed sharing with parents with or without a compressed abdomen</p>
                    </list-item>
                    <list-item>
                        <p>descriptions of mothers or fathers rolling on the baby after a night of drinking or</p>
                    </list-item>
                    <list-item>
                        <p>finding of baby in a prone position with a cloth in the mouth or muffled by blankets</p>
                    </list-item>
                </list>
                <p>In the second step, the coded data was then uploaded into 
                    <ext-link ext-link-type="uri" xlink:href="https://www.sas.com/en_gb/home.html">SAS</ext-link> software v9.4 (SAS Institute Inc., Cary, NC, USA) (RRID:SCR_008567) and quantitatively analyzed (The analysis can also be performed using 
                    <ext-link ext-link-type="uri" xlink:href="http://www.r-project.org/">R</ext-link> Statistical Software (v4.2.1; R Core Team 2022) (RRID:SCR_001905)). We calculated frequencies and percentages for dichotomous and categorical data and estimated mean and standard deviation for continuous data. We used logistic regression for univariate and multivariate analysis to test statistical differences between symptomatic and asymptomatic deaths on key infant, maternal and other demographic risk factors of SUIDs. All statistical analysis were conducted at a 0.05 significance level. We calculated odds ratios (OR), and 95% confidence intervals (95% CI) to show statistical differences in univariate and multivariate analysis. Included are sample narratives for SUID cases to show our coding decisions.</p>

            <sec>
                <title>Cause of death</title>
                <p>Most of the BID infants, 92.6% (749/809), presented with symptoms prior to death with 38.2% (309/809) presenting with respiratory symptoms and 54.4% (440/809) with non-respiratory or other symptoms. The proportions of each cause of death identified in the narratives are shown in 
                    <xref ref-type="table" rid="T2">Table 2</xref>. However, 7.4% (60/809) presented with no preceding symptoms and were classified as suspected SUIDs. Of these, 27% (16/60) had narratives that were suggestive of accidental suffocation or strangulation in bed (ASSB) and 73% (44/60) were classified as suspected SIDS. 
                    <xref ref-type="table" rid="T3">Table 3</xref> and 
                    <xref ref-type="table" rid="T4">Table 4</xref> contain a verbatim list of representative narratives for possible SIDS and ASSB to show the coding decisions made in distinguishing between these two causes of SUIDs. A full list of narratives has been included as supplementary tables.</p>

            <sec>
                <title>Suspected SUID cases</title>
                <p>
                    <bold>
                        <italic toggle="yes">Peak age of SUID.</italic>
                    </bold> 
                    <xref ref-type="fig" rid="f1">Figure 1</xref> summarizes the distribution of suspected SUID cases by age, time of death, month, and season. The mean age of suspected SUID cases was 2.1 months. Overall, deaths were concentrated in infants younger than two months with a peak age of 1&#x2013;2 months. More importantly, we found that a quarter, 25% (15/60) of SUID deaths occurred in infants within the first month of life although it has generally been considered that SUIDs are rare in the neonatal period.</p>
                <fig fig-type="figure" id="f1" orientation="portrait" position="float">
                    <label>Figure 1. </label>
                    <caption>
                        <title>Distribution of suspected sudden unexpected infant death (SUID) cases by age, time of day, month, and season of death. </title>
                        <p>
                            <bold>A</bold>. Age distribution of suspected SUID cases. 
                            <bold>B</bold>. Distribution of suspected SUID cases by time of day. 
                            <bold>C</bold>. Monthly distribution of suspected SUID cases. 
                            <bold>D</bold>. Seasonal* distribution of suspected SUID cases. 
                            <bold>*</bold> Hot and Rainy: Nov, Dec, Jan, Feb, Mar, Apr; Cold and Dry: May, Jun, Jul, Aug; Hot and Dry: Sept, Oct.</p>
                    </caption>
                    <graphic orientation="portrait" position="float" xlink:href="https://gatesopenresearch-files.f1000.com/manuscripts/15614/a123e95a-c8bf-4e3f-bc77-6a10d3b1d094_figure1.gif"/>
                </fig>
                <p>
                    <bold>
                        <italic toggle="yes">Time of day of SUID.</italic>
                    </bold> All the suspected SUID cases occurred during sleep with peak incidence in the night, 37% (22/60), and early morning, 38% (23/60). Very few occurred in the evening, 15% (9/60) with even fewer in the afternoon, 10% (6/60).</p>
                <p>
                    <bold>
                        <italic toggle="yes">Month and season of SUID.</italic>
                    </bold> The majority of the suspected SUID cases occurred in the cold months of May, June, July, and August with peak incidence in August, 15% (9/60). By season, this corresponds to the cold and dry seasons of Lusaka. Half of the suspected SUID deaths occurred in the cold and dry season with almost 40% (24/60) occurring during the rainy season. Fewer deaths occurred in the hot and dry season of September and October.</p>
                <p>
                    <bold>
                        <italic toggle="yes">Univariate and multivariate analysis of factors associated with SUID.</italic>
                    </bold> In univariate analysis, age of death in months and time of death were found to be statistically associated with an asymptomatic presentation. Compared to infants aged less than one month, infants aged between one and two months had 2.6 times increased odds of suspected SUIDs, and this risk was statistically significant (OR: 2.6, 95% CI: 1.31&#x2013;5.27). The odds of SUID occurring in the night was also 2.64 times higher compared to the afternoon (OR: 2.64, 95% CI: 1.04&#x2013;6.63). There was an increased odds of SUIDs for female infants, mothers with low education or no employment, larger families with four or more children and the cold/dry season. However, these were not significant with 95% CI which contained the null value as shown in 
                    <xref ref-type="table" rid="T6">Table 6</xref>. In multivariate analysis, infants aged between one and two months had 2.84 increased odds of suspected SUIDs compared to infants in the first month of life (AOR = 2.84, 95% CI: 1.31, 6.16). Unemployed mothers also had 2.49 increased odds of suspected SUID compared to salaried or self-employed mothers (AOR: 2.49, 95% CI: 1.02, 6.08)</p>

        <sec sec-type="discussion">
            <title>Discussion</title>
            <p>Our main finding from this analysis is that apparent sudden unexpected infant death accounts for 7.4% of all BIDS in Lusaka, Zambia of which 5.4% were apparent SIDS deaths and 2% were likely due to accidental suffocation. While there is a dearth of data describing the burden of SUID across most of Africa
                <sup>
                    <xref ref-type="bibr" rid="ref-12">12</xref>
                </sup>, our findings are similar to estimates of SUID from South Africa, where SIDS/SUID deaths accounted for between 6.2% to 8.7% of all infant deaths in medico legal laboratories
                <sup>
                    <xref ref-type="bibr" rid="ref-13">13</xref>,
                    <xref ref-type="bibr" rid="ref-14">14</xref>
                </sup>. These findings suggests that SIDS/SUIDs are an important cause of infant death in Zambia; however, it is going unreported.</p>
            <p>Our analysis revealed three noteworthy findings. Firstly, the peak age of SUID in our analysis was one to two months. Age at death was the only factor that was significant in multivariate analysis with infants aged one to two months at significantly higher odds of SUID compared to infants in the first year of life. Our findings are different from estimates in the U.S. and other high-income countries where the peak age of SUID has been reported as two to four months
                <sup>
                    <xref ref-type="bibr" rid="ref-15">15</xref>
                </sup>. However, our findings are similar to findings by Heathfield 
                <italic toggle="yes">et al</italic>. in South Africa where they reported a peak age of one to two months in SUID cases
                <sup>
                    <xref ref-type="bibr" rid="ref-16">16</xref>
                </sup>. In addition, we found a quarter of our SUID cases occurred in the first month of life. The triple risk model suggest that SIDS occurs in a vulnerable infant at a critical period of development in the presence of an exogenous stressor
                <sup>
                    <xref ref-type="bibr" rid="ref-17">17</xref>
                </sup>. More than half of the SUID cases occurred in families residing in the densely populated peri-urban townships surrounding Lusaka. We hypothesize that these infants are exposed to exogenous stressors at a much earlier age such as infections compared to infants in high-income countries. Moreover, Heathfield 
                <italic toggle="yes">et al</italic>. hypothesized that infants in overcrowded settlements experience a faster decline in maternal IgG than infants in high-income countries, making them vulnerable to sudden death at an earlier age
                <sup>
                    <xref ref-type="bibr" rid="ref-16">16</xref>
                </sup>.</p>
            <p>Secondly, more than half of our SUID cases were female (51.7% vs 33.3%). This finding is different from what has been reported elsewhere. Most studies report higher rates of SUIDs in males than females
                <sup>
                    <xref ref-type="bibr" rid="ref-18">18</xref>
                </sup>. Although not statistically significant, we found females to be at increased odds of SUID compared to males. However, this finding should be interpreted with caution since 12.2% of our cases were missing a gender assignment. We also found the same socio-economic risk factors that have been reported previously including higher SUID cases among unemployed mothers, mothers with lower educational attainment, larger families with more than four children, during the cold season, and in the early morning hours when infants are sleeping
                <sup>
                    <xref ref-type="bibr" rid="ref-19">19</xref>&#x2013;
                    <xref ref-type="bibr" rid="ref-21">21</xref>
                </sup>, confirming the presence of some of the risk factors of SIDS in these communities.</p>
            <sec>
                <title>Policy implications</title>
                <p>This is the first study to report on the prevalence of SUIDs in Zambia and the first study to describe the burden of SUID in Africa outside of South Africa. Our findings suggest SUID could be accounting for a significant proportion of infant deaths, but this cause of infant mortality is going unrecognized. The risk factors of SUIDs are modifiable with simple interventions. This study shows that there is a large enough burden of disease to merit the implementation of specific interventions or programs targeted at reducing sudden infant death in this population. A sudden infant death can be stressful to the family especially young mothers. Some of the narratives were heart breaking. A common theme in these narratives was a need to understand what caused the death of their child. The response to a SIDS/SUID death has been one of blame and sometimes mothers have been criminalized on suspicion that they intentionally caused the death of their child. We want to shed a light on this important cause of infant mortality and make a case for increased research as well as the implementation of targeted campaigns and programs on SIDS in Zambia.</p>
            </sec>
            <sec>
                <title>Limitations</title>
                <p>A key limitation of this study is that we relied on VA narratives to assign a cause of death. We did not conduct a death scene investigation or formal autopsy. For that reason, we consider these to be &#x2018;presumptive&#x2019; SUID cases since they lack the gold standard evaluation. With that said, the apparent burden revealed in our analysis is very similar to what has been described in South Africa using that gold standard evaluation and is also consistent with what was described in high-income settings prior to the introduction of SIDS interventions. While there could be some misclassification, the most parsimonious explanation is that most of these are indeed examples of SUID. Another limitation is that we did not collect any information on other key risk factors of SIDS such as maternal smoking or alcohol use and infant sleep practices from the mothers of the deceased infants. However, in a separate analysis recently accepted for publication, we report a high prevalence of SUID risk factors and behaviors from mothers of infants in the same communities as in the current cohort. These included low rates of sleeping in a prone position as recommended, high frequency of bed sharing, bundling of infants with duvets and blankets, and exposure to indoor air pollution and alcohol use
                    <sup>
                        <xref ref-type="bibr" rid="ref-22">22</xref>
                    </sup>.</p>

            <p>This is a really interesting study and addresses a new area &#x2013; SIDS in sub-Saharan Africa, of which very little is known.&#x00a0; The major limitation is that the diagnosis of SIDS relies on a full post-mortem examination, which of course has not taken place, verbal autopsy is no substitute. &#x00a0;Around 1/3 of unexpected infant deaths have a cause determined at post-mortem, it is likely that a similar proportion of deaths classified as SIDS in this study were due to other causes.</p>
            <p> </p>
            <p> The coding used to classify deaths as SIDS or accidental suffocation will introduce further inaccuracies. Minor symptoms of non-specific viral illness are commonly reported in infants who die of SIDS, particularly coryza, reduced feeding and mild cough. By excluding any infant with minor symptoms the number of SIDS cases will be underestimated as these cases will be misclassified as due to disease. The finding of blood or vomitus/milk from the nose/mouth of a baby is very common in all sudden unexpected infant death, including SIDS. It does not support a diagnosis of accidental suffocation.&#x00a0; Using this to classify deaths as accidental suffocation will lead to overestimation of deaths from suffocation.&#x00a0; By this rationale case 2 in table 4 should not be classified as accidental suffocation.</p>
            <p> </p>
            <p> The results are therefore no more than an educated guess &#x2013; all they can show is that SIDS likely happens in Zambia but the frequency of SIDS remains unclear.&#x00a0; Therefore the calculated associations will have a high degree of error. However, it is still an important study showing that further research in SIDS in sub-Saharan Africa is vital, and safe-sleep campaigns to prevent SIDS have potential to reduce infant mortality.</p>
            <p> </p>
            <p> Minor Points: The numbers in the abstract don&#x2019;t add up correctly &#x2013; 16 accidental suffocation and 54 SIDS = 70 not 60. The most recent SIDS international consensus on SIDS diagnosis is the 2004 San Diego definition (Krous et al)</p>
